Milwaukee Bucks Injury Report – Will Damian Lillard play in Game 3 against the Indiana Pacers?

The news of Damian Lillard’s DVT diagnosis took the NBA world by storm. Just a few prior, Victor Wembanyama got shut down for the 2024/25 season for the same reason. It appeared as though Dame’s season was over, and with it, the Bucks’ title campaign, as well. However, as we can see, Dame made a miraculous recovery to help his time.

And even a cursory glance at the Bucks’ injury report reveals that this recovery has stuck. Damian Lillard is not on the Bucks’ injury report for Game 3. He is AVAILABLE for Game 3 in this first-round Playoff series against Indiana.

The only player present on the Bucks’ injury report is Tyler Smith. His availability for Game 3 remains QUESTIONABLE as he deals with an ankle injury. Smith has been unavailable for the last 3 Milwaukee games. Even when he’s healthy, though, Smith doesn’t feature too heavily in the Bucks’ rotation. So it’s not like they’re missing a key player.

Similarly, the Indiana Pacers are missing only one player as well. Isaiah Jackson is still in recovery after tearing his Achilles tendon in November last year. He is OUT for the third game against Milwaukee. And Pacers fans; don’t expect him to make a comeback anytime soon.

But that’s it for the injured personnel on both teams. Damian Lillard no longer being among the injured will certainly be a huge boost to this Bucks team. However, can Dame recapture the form he was in ahead of the devastating DVT diagnosis?

Damian Lillard needs to step up big-time if the Bucks want a comeback in this series

Dame played against the Pacers in Game 2 so he could give the Bucks a lift. That’s why he called Doc Rivers in the morning despite being out for a month because of the health scare. However, things didn’t end up going Dame’s or the Bucks’ way.

They lost 123-115, and the Pacers went 2-0 up in the series. Dame himself had quite a slow night. He registered 14 points, going 4-13 from the field. His 3-point shooting also left a lot to be desired, with only a quarter of his shots from beyond the arc finding their mark. With the high-stakes third game on the horizon, Damian Lillard cannot afford another similar showing.
